BP spends $3b as clean up cost for oil spill

BP has spent more than $3 billion as clean up cost on oil spill in the Gulf of Mexico, the company said in a statement.

The total amount the company has spent to date comes around $3.12 billion, including the cost of the spill response, containment, relief well drilling, grants to the Gulf states, claims paid, and federal costs, the company said.

Approximately 44,500 personnel, more than 6,563 vessels and some 113 aircraft are currently engaged in the response effort. The total length of containment boom deployed as part of efforts to prevent oil from reaching the coast is now almost 2.9 million feet.

On June 16, BP announced an agreed package of measures, including the creation of a $20 billion escrow account to satisfy certain obligations arising from the oil and gas spill.
